Transaction 6e23c38c51fbba0376c197713688a464db76653e8f4b4f7167c9888c01ba249e

1 Input
2 Outputs
  • 6e23c38c51fbba0376c197713688a464db76653e8f4b4f7167c9888c01ba249e:0
  • value  10000000
    address  3BMEXFsMkuSwHCfbpcxihLbexCq49xUsC1
  • 6e23c38c51fbba0376c197713688a464db76653e8f4b4f7167c9888c01ba249e:1
  • value  11397178
    address  33Y4ozMakTE2B3wYvwfmeSkfqAVwyMLG2Y